Verdict

Nada Moo! Dairy-Free Chocolate Frozen Dessert is a coconut-based frozen treat designed as a plant-based alternative to traditional ice cream. Its main strength is low sodium, while its main tradeoff is high saturated fat. Overall, it serves as a dessert option for those avoiding dairy and refined sugars.

Nutrition Overview

The profile is dominated by saturated fat from coconut, with very little protein or fiber to balance the calorie density. However, it contains significantly less added sugar than many other frozen desserts.

Ingredient Analysis

The base consists of organic coconut milk and agave syrup, which provides the creamy texture and sweetness. The formulation is rounded out with inulin, tapioca syrup, and industrial gums to maintain consistency and mouthfeel.

Ingredients

Organic Coconut Milk, Water, Organic Agave Syrup, Inulin, Tapioca Syrup, Cocoa Powder (Processed with Alkali), Guar Gum, Sea Salt, Locust Bean Gum, Natural Flavor.
